The Basics of Hair Transplant Surgery

A Hair Transplant in Riyadh involves taking hair from areas of the scalp that have thicker hair growth (usually the back or sides) and transplanting it to areas experiencing hair loss. The transplanted hair follicles are genetically resistant to hair thinning, ensuring that the new hair will continue to grow for years to come. There are different techniques used to perform the transplant, each with its own advantages and considerations.

Common Hair Transplant Techniques in Riyadh

In Riyadh, hair transplant clinics offer a variety of cutting-edge procedures that cater to individual needs. The two most widely used techniques are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T) and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E). Let’s explore these in more detail:

1.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T)

FUT, often referred to as the “strip method,” involves removing a thin strip of scalp from the donor area (usually the back of the head) where hair is plentiful. The strip is then divided into small grafts containing one to four hair follicles. These grafts are meticulously placed into the balding or thinning areas.

  • Pros: FUT is ideal for patients who require a larger number of grafts in a single session. Since the procedure involves removing a strip of skin, more hair follicles can be harvested at once.
  • Cons: One downside of FUT is that it leaves a linear scar in the donor area, which may be visible if the patient wears their hair short. The recovery time is also slightly longer than other techniques.

2.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E)

FUE is a more modern and minimally invasive technique. It involves individually extracting hair follicles from the donor area using a specialized tool and implanting them into the recipient area. Unlike FUT, FUE does not involve removing a strip of scalp, which means less scarring.

  • Pros: FUE leaves no visible scarring, making it a popular choice for patients who prefer shorter hairstyles. It also allows for a quicker recovery time and is less invasive overall.
  • Cons: FUE tends to take longer than FUT because each follicle is harvested individually. It may also require multiple sessions for larger areas of hair loss.

3. Direct Hair Implantation (DHI)

Direct Hair Implantation (DHI) is an advanced version of the FUE technique. With DHI, surgeons use a specialized pen-like device to implant the harvested follicles directly into the scalp. This method offers greater precision and can result in more natural-looking hair growth.

  • Pros: DHI minimizes the time hair follicles are outside the body, which can improve the survival rate of transplanted hairs. It also allows for more control over the angle and direction of hair placement.
  • Cons: DHI tends to be more expensive than other methods due to the advanced tools and techniques required.

The Hair Transplant Process: Step by Step

1. Initial Consultation

Before undergoing a hair transplant in Riyadh, patients must first have a consultation with a qualified surgeon. During this consultation, the doctor will assess the patient’s hair loss pattern, scalp condition, and medical history to determine whether they are a suitable candidate for the procedure. The doctor will also discuss the patient’s goals and expectations to tailor the treatment plan accordingly.

2. Preparation for the Procedure

Once a treatment plan is agreed upon, the patient will be prepared for surgery. The preparation process involves shaving the donor and recipient areas, sterilizing the scalp, and administering local anesthesia to ensure the patient remains comfortable throughout the procedure.

3. Extraction and Implantation

Depending on the technique chosen, the surgeon will either remove a strip of scalp (in FUT) or extract individual hair follicles (in FUE or DHI).

4. Post-Operative Care

After the procedure, the patient will receive detailed aftercare instructions. These instructions typically include how to wash the scalp, avoid direct sun exposure, and manage any post-operative discomfort. In most cases, patients are able to return to normal activities within a few days, though the full healing process can take several weeks.

Recovery and Results

The recovery time for a hair transplant varies depending on the technique used. With FUT, patients may experience more swelling and discomfort due to the larger incision, while FUE and DHI patients often enjoy a quicker recovery with less visible scarring. Regardless of the method, most patients will see scabbing and redness around the transplant site, which usually resolves within 7-10 days.

Hair growth from the transplanted follicles typically begins about 3-4 months after the surgery. Full results are usually visible within 12 to 18 months. The transplanted hair is permanent and will grow naturally, blending with the patient’s existing hair.

How Much Does a Hair Transplant Cost in Riyadh?

Hair transplant costs in Riyadh can vary depending on factors such as the clinic’s reputation, the surgeon’s experience, and the number of grafts needed. On average, prices range from SAR 10,000 to SAR 30,000 (approximately $2,700 to $8,000).

Choosing the Right Hair Transplant Clinic in Riyadh

Selecting the right clinic is crucial for achieving optimal results. Here are some key factors to consider when choosing a hair transplant clinic in Riyadh:

  1. Surgeon’s Experience: Make sure the surgeon is board-certified and has a proven track record in hair restoration. Research their experience, education, and patient testimonials.
  2. Technology: The best clinics use the latest technology for hair transplants, such as robotic-assisted FUE or advanced DHI tools.
  3. Patient Reviews: Check for before-and-after photos, online reviews, and patient testimonials to gauge the clinic’s reputation.
  4. Post-Operative Care: A good clinic will provide detailed post-operative instructions and follow-up care to ensure the patient heals properly and achieves the best possible results.
